#d00152 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d00152 is composed of 81.6% red, 0.4%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 99.5% magenta, 60.6%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 336.5 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 41%. #d00152 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ff02a4 with #a10000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#d00152 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d00152 has RGB values of R:208, G:1,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0, M:1, Y:0.61,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13631826.

Shades and Tints of #d00152
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0005 is the darkest color, while #fff8fb is the lightest one.
